Trochactaeon

Trochactaeon is an extinct genus of fossil sea snails, marine gastropod mollusks in the family Acteonellidae.

The genus Trochactaeon is known from the Late Cretaceous to the Early Cretaceous periods.[2]

Species

Species in the genus Trochactaeon include:

  • Trochactaeon conicus - late Cretaceous
  • Trochactaeon crisimensis Choffat, 1966[3]
